Jaguar Cub

The latest AC motor drive from IMO is a powerful new inverter that fits in the palm of your hand

Automation and control specialist IMO Precision and Controls has unveiled a new range of technologically advanced AC motor drives. Compact enough to fit on the palm of your hand, the new Jaguar Cub inverter delivers extremely high performance.  Carrying all the low-cost, high-functionality features expected of IMO's "Cub brand" the new 'baby' Jaguar is the perfect design solution, for both OEM and end users alike, in applications whenever space and performance are at a premium.

The new Jaguar Cub drives deliver a higher motor starting torque using STV technology, a simplified version of IMO Jaguar's renowned torque-vector control system for consistently powerful operation.  Running at 5Hz and employing advanced magnetic flux estimator and motor slip compensation with auto-boost, starting torque can be as much as 150% or more.

The new drive is available in ratings from 0.4kW through to 2.2kW in single phase / 230V, and 0.4kW to 4kW in 3 phase / 400V. Cubs rated 1.5kW and above can be specified with an integral braking resistor, while smaller models can easily be connected to an external bolt-on braking resistor option making it ideal for applications such as stopping higher inertia loads that call for large reserves of regenerative braking power.

By keeping motor loss to a minimum, the Jaguar Cub saves electrical power in fan or pump applications and thanks to its unique technology improves voltage control performance and reduces motor instability at low speed to about a half or less, at 1Hz, than that of a conventional inverter. Even when the motor load fluctuates, the slip compensation function ensures smooth operation.

The Jaguar Cub comes with timer operation, input and output phase loss protection, loss-of-load protection and thermostatically operated long-life cooling fans designed to operate for 7 years at 40 degrees centigrade. To reduce audible noise and save even more energy, the Cub's cooling fan can be turned off when not required. The Cub allows the connection of a DC reactor to limit mains supply circuit harmonics and is fitted with a PTC thermistor input and PID control.

RS485 or Modbus RTU type communications are supported via an optional internal interface card.  Jaguar Loader software can be used to set-up, monitor performance, interrogate alarm conditions using the standard RS485 comms link.  Other features include side-by-side mounting to IP20, on-board frequency setting potentiometer, non-linear V/F pattern and an auto-energy optimiser.   There is also an optional remote operator keypad panel, complete with parameter copy function, and extension cable for panel door mounting.

Like all IMO Jaguar drives, the new Cub comes with a full five-year warranty.
